Types of Welding Certificates

Although the American Welding Society’s regular CW (Certified Welder) certificate paves the way for the majority of positions, some fields will require their own specialized certificate. Some of the most-common of these are highlighted below.

  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certificates for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
  • API Certification for welders who deal with pipelines in the gas and oil field
  • Certified Welder Certification to become a Certified Welder
  • ASME Certification for those who work with boiler and pressure vessels

The subsequent graphic displays jobs and wage forecasts for professional welders in the State of Montana through 2022.

Montana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 1,320 1,440 10% 50
Montana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$23,400 $33,800 $58,100

Source: O*Net Online

It’s very highly encouraged that you take the time to make sure that you verify that the welding specialist program or school that you are deciding on is actually endorsed by the AWS or any other accrediting group. If your school is approved by these agencies, you ought to also take a look at some other features including:

  • Make certain the program teaches on machinery that satisfies up-to-date trade standards
  • Determine if the school gives financial assistance
  • Make sure that the college’s curriculum provides courses in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
  • Look for courses that cover AWS SENSE standards
